Bill Pennebaker, 44 Missions, original crew, with almost all as Command Pilot. A real survivor. |
![]() |
Andy Anzanos, Engineer/TT, 26 missions, Nov. 1943 through March 1944. Survived combat to be shot down by friendly fire. |
![]() |
John Warner, Co-pilot, 35 Missions, including surviving a catastrophe and escaping on one engine. |
![]() |
Richard Bushong, Co-pilot and Pilot, 28 missions, starting Dec. 1943. His survival of numerous catastrophes is astounding. Later he became a test pilot. |
![]() |
“Ben” Bennett Pilot of “Squawkin Chicken”, sole squadron survivor on his second mission with the 384th Bomb Group. His humor comes through on this tape to further make a treasured item. |
